Aunque algunos bugs se vean como algo chistoso o auténtico son errores y deberían reportarse. 👁
Introducción
Qué aprenderás sobre el testing de videojuegos
¿Cómo funciona el testing de Black Box en un estudio de videojuegos?
Diferencia entre los 2 QA’s
Testing de Regresión y Testing Exploratorio
Primer quiz
Tipos de Testing
Tipos de Testing: Funcional, Lingüístico y de Localización
Tipos de Testing: Online, Compliance, Usabilidad y Play Test
Ejemplos de casos de pruebas de baterías de testing
Segundo quiz
Reporte de bugs y Tipos de bugs
Qué es un bug y la importancia del reporte de errores
Bug Writing Format
Prioridades de los bugs y prioridad según su ruta
Tipos de bugs: texto, gráfico, funcional, gameplay
Tipos de bugs: Crash, Freezee, Framerate, Audio, Legal
Reto: reporta los bugs
Áreas de un juego y bugs duplicados
RETO: encuentra 10 Bugs en un juego
Test plan
Sistema de Trabajo
Test plan
Organizando nuestro test plan
Continuando el proceso de creación de test Plan y tu primera batería de pruebas
Baterías de pruebas especiales
RETO: 3 cosas que consideras prioritarias antes de empezar a testear
Testing en celulares
Guía Android
Testing en celulares Android
Guía iOS
Testing en consolas
Reto: Test Plan
uTest
uTest: creando tu perfil
uTest: proyectos pagados, reportes de bugs y pagos
Cierre del curso
Charla motivacional
Reto final
No tienes acceso a esta clase
¡Continúa aprendiendo! Únete y comienza a potenciar tu carrera
En esta clase aprenderemos a clasificar los bugs según su importancia y según su ruta.
Las prioridades de los bugs se dividen en:
Minor: errores muy pequeños. Por ejemplo pequeños desajustes en la gráfica o en el texto. Se deben reportar todos los errores por minúsculos que sean.
Major: errores estándar que no impiden el progreso del jugador en el juego.
Critical: errores extremadamente vistosos que impiden el progreso en el juego pero no impiden terminar el juego.
Blocker: errores graves que detienen el progreso del jugador en el juego.
La clasificación de los bugs según su ruta se refiere a los pasos que se deben seguir para llegar al punto donde encontramos el bug. En este sentido, la prioridad se divide en:
Low: se requieren muchos pasos muy específicos para reproducir el bug. Es poco probable que un jugador llegue a encontrarlo. Un bug de tipo blocker que se encuentre en una ruta low puede considerarse critical.
High: son muy pocos los pasos y las condiciones para llegar a este bug y por lo tanto es muy probable que un jugador se encuentre con él. Un bug de tipo major que se encuentre en una ruta high puede considerarse critical.
Aportes 23
Preguntas 1
Aunque algunos bugs se vean como algo chistoso o auténtico son errores y deberían reportarse. 👁
Minor: errores muy pequeños. Por ejemplo pequeños desajustes en la gráfica o en el texto. Se deben reportar todos los errores por minúsculos que sean.
Mayor: errores estándar que no impiden el progreso del jugador en el juego.
Critical: errores extremadamente vistosos que impiden el progreso en el juego pero no impiden terminal el juego.
Blocker: errores graves que detienen el progreso del jugador en el juego.
La clasificación de los bugs según su ruta se refiere a los pasos que se deben seguir para llegar al punto donde encontramos el bug. En este sentido, la prioridad se divide en:
Low: se requieren muchos pasos muy específicos para reproducir el bug, es poco probable que un jugador llegue a encontrarlo. Un bug de tipo blocker que se encuentre en una ruta low puede considerarse critical.
High: son muy pocos los pasos y las condiciones para llegar a este bug y por lo tanto es muy probable que un jugador se encuentre con él. Un bug de tipo mayor que se encuentre en una ruta high puede considerarse critical.
Preguntas para determinar nivel de prioridad:
-¿Detiene el progreso del juego?
-¿Es vistoso?
-¿Es difícil de encontrar?
enserio que me esta encantando este curso de tester ver todo esto hace que uno vea mas alla de solo la pantalla sino de todo el proceso que hay que hacer para llegar a reparar un problema y que de esta manera el jugador tenga la mejor eperiencia
Un tester puede recomendar alguna mejora en el juego? y si lo puede como se llama eso?
Me acuerdo cuando viví un gran blocker jugando Silent Hill Homecoming, en una escena en alcantarilla tenia que matar unos monstruos para que se abra la compuerta y ayudar a una chica a pasar, ahí grabe y salí del juego, cuando entre nuevamente la chica si había pasado pero yo estaba al otro lado y al matar a los bichos no se abrió la puerta y no pude avanzar, tuve que dejar de jugar el juego porque me dio pereza repetir.
Prioridad
Minor: errores pequeños y de carácter más estéticos. Un ejemplo es que en determinado momento las gráficas se pixelean.
Mayor: errores standard, no impiden el progreso del juego pero afecta el mismo. Un ejemplo es que estamos combatiendo con espadas y el sonido del choque las mismas esté corrido del golpe.
Critical: errores extremadamente vistosos y afectan el juego de manera visual pero que nos permite concluir el juego. Un ejemplo puede ser en la elección del personaje con el que vamos a jugar y que cuando comienza el juego este cambie por otro.
Blocker: error más grave ya que evita que concluyamos el juego. Uno de los ejemplos es que el juego se paralice o directamente salga del mismo. Son errores que no nos permiten disfrutar de la experiencia del juego.
Según Ruta
Low: son los errores que tienen poca probabilidad de suceder ya que necesitan varias condiciones para que se ejecuten como tales. Uno de los ejemplos es que para que se ejecute tenga que cumplir con X personaje, Y armadura y X herramienta. Son muy pocas las probabilidades que jugando tenga estas tres características.
High: es un error que se repite constantemente.
La Severidad debería ser tomada en cuenta tambien, que tan severo es el bug para el software o juego en si. En relacion a la Prioridad o que tan rapido deberia ser atacado, en muchos casos te podes encontrar con que se identifico un bug de muy baja severidad como puede ser el error cosmetico mencionado con prioridad Minor pero para la etapa del ciclo arreglarlo es clave, ya sea por estar priorizando el polishing o porque segun determinados guidelines por ejemplo de Compliance tiene que ser fixeado ASAP.
’ COD 5.1 - PS4 5.5 - Trophies and achievements - ‘King shooter’ achievement text is shown in uppercase when it should be lowercase '
Podria ser Minor en Severity , pero Critical en Priority.
Creo que es util hacer esa diferenciación para cualquier game tester
Creo que una concepto mas comprensible para las prioridades en los reportes de los Bugs, seria la palabra Severidad, se adapta mejor a los diferentes tipos de las prioridades expuestas en esta clase.
Aún recuerdo mi primer Bug BLOCKER jugando Spyro de ps1. Al querer pasar al siguiente mundo, la pantalla de carga se quedaba tildada y no dejaba avanzar.
Tengo una pregunta…
Por ejemplo lo que esta pasando con cyberpunk 2077, todos los errores y bug, no fueron vistos por los testers Compliance, entonces seria su culpa?
O de los que obligaron a que se estrene rápido???
Low:
<se requieren muchos pasos muy específicos para reproducir el bug. Es poco probable que un jugador llegue a encontrarlo. Un bug de tipo blocker que se encuentre en una ruta low puede considerarse critical.
>
En que parte del bug writing report definimos la prioridad segun la ruta?
Excelente explicación
COMO PASA:Un crash pasa cuando tu pc no es lo suficientemente buena para correr tal juego se va a crashear seguramente y si no va a ir con lag o sea lento.
QUE ES:Un crash es un error que ocurre normalmente, se te cierra el juego o se queda cargando da error y se cierra .
Sugiero en vez de hacer que una variable afecte a otra como está sugiriendo el profesor, se añada una 3ra variable llamada promedio / ponderado / permisibilidad / aceptabilidad / semaforización / riesgo / costo-beneficio, cómo en una matriz de riesgos donde se consideran el impacto y probabilidad que en este caso son lo mismo que prioridad y ruta con otros nombres, pero al final se clasifica por color de acuerdo a una calificación entre las 2 variables, no xq sea más probable significa que cambiará la otra variable de impacto / prioridad.
¡Excelente clase! 😃
Interesante la clasificación de los errores.
Excelente la clase y los aportes de la comunidad.
Tengo una duda si sucede el error en la mitad del juego se clasificaría en la parte de ruta como high o low? o depende de los pasos a seguir si son muy específicos?
Si el bug es minor pero se vuelve un explotó del usuario que da ventajas sobre los demás jugadores, a qué nivel podría subir?? podría ser critical?
Genial
¿Quieres ver más aportes, preguntas y respuestas de la comunidad?